Marines MOS 7051

Aircraft Rescue and Firefighting Specialist

Marines 7051 (Aircraft Rescue and Firefighting Specialist) typically involves aviation mission support and aircraft-related duties, emergency response and firefighting work.

Common Exposures

๐Ÿ”Š Noise
Flight line noise from jet engines and aircraft
๐Ÿงช Chemicals
Aviation fuels, solvents, hydraulic fluids, lubricants
๐Ÿ’ช Physical Strain
Lifting heavy components, working in confined aircraft spaces
๐Ÿงช Chemicals
AFFF foam, toxic fumes, smoke inhalation
๐Ÿ’ช Physical Strain
Heavy gear, rescue operations
๐Ÿช– Combat/Stress
Emergency response, witnessing casualties

Likely Service-Connected Conditions

Diagnostic Code Condition Likelihood Reasoning
5237 Lumbosacral or cervical strain High Heavy gear and physical rescue operations
6260 Tinnitus, recurrent High Constant flight line noise exposure
5242 Degenerative arthritis, degenerative disc disease other than intervertebral disc syndrome (also, see either DC 5003 or 5010) Medium Repetitive heavy lifting
6847 Sleep Apnea Syndromes Medium Shift work and irregular schedules
9411 Posttraumatic stress disorder Medium Emergency response trauma
9434 Major depressive disorder Medium High-stress environment
